## Sensor drift: what to do at 3am

If the GrowLoop controller starts reporting humidity swings that don't match the backup probes in the Fernwick greenhouse, it's almost always sensor drift, not an actual climate event. Don't panic and don't touch the vents manually. First, restart the calibration daemon and give it ten minutes to re-baseline. If readings still disagree by more than 5%, flip the controller into safe mode. The safe-mode thresholds it will use are these.

config for yahap-bajof:
[istix]
host = istix.qorvelsys.internal
user = istix_svc
database = istix_prod

Dark-mode theming in the Lanterline admin dashboard is resolved at render time, so plugins must not hardcode palette values. Use the theme tokens exposed by the PanelKit SDK instead. To test your plugin against the hosted preview sandbox, you need the sandbox credential configured locally. Append this line to your plugin's .env before running the preview:

secret setting of hawep-yahig: LEDGER_TOKEN29=41b5d6315371c92885eaeb077fb63

Quick note before you approve the Hartloom split: carving the user module out of the monolith roughly doubles auth-path RPC traffic, so we pre-sized the new pool with headroom for the Lanternfell launch. Nothing exotic, but sanity-check the numbers against prod graphs. The proposed sizing constants follow below.

tuning table, hafog-bahaf:
QUOTAS = {
    "praion": 144,
    "briax": 906,
    "silwyn": 451,
}

Ticket: SweepVault retention sweeper failing since Tuesday. The sweeper's service credential for the ArchiveGate API expired at rotation, so nightly deletion jobs against the coldstore buckets are silently skipping batches. No data was over-retained beyond the 30-day grace window yet, but the backlog grows roughly 40k records per night. We rotated the credential through the Keysmith console and verified scopes are limited to delete-only on retention-tagged objects. For audit purposes, the replacement key issued today is recorded below.

service key, fawip-bajef: kto11_Qt5wZK9vdNC